That’s the thing that caught me when Eddie Rodriguez tagged me on his ‘‘biggest fish to date,’’ a 27.5-pound blue catfish caught Saturday on the cool side of Braidwood Lake.

Joy.

In recent years, I feel as though fishing and hunting have slipped into facts and figures, forgoing the human element and focusing more on how-to than why-do.

The human element really showed in the face of Eddie’s son, Mark. The photo of him shows a heart bursting with the joy of a big fish. There was a bonus reason for that expression.

‘‘That was my son’s first time on the boat and full of excitement,’’ Rodriguez messaged. ‘‘I think he was my lucky charm. I told my son, ‘I think I have a fish,’ when I saw the rod moving. When the reel started screaming, my son said, ‘You definitely have a fish.’ ’’

fotw09_13_17.jpg

Blues are relatively recent stockings at Braidwood, the cooling lake in southwestern Will County.

As for the facts and figures, Rodriguez caught it in a 30-foot hole with 82-degree water with a bluegill tail on a Gamakatsu circle hook. He was using a 25-pound fluorocarbon leader and 40-pound PowerPro braided line on a Quantum reel on a St Croix rod.

Those are the facts and figures that fix joy in memory.

‘‘I let the fish go, so someone else can catch it, as well,’’ Rodriguez messaged.
